How Does Video Assessment Work Behind the Scenes?
Two architectures compete here, and understanding the difference tells you what you’re actually paying for. Server-rendered editors upload your footage to a cloud render farm, queue it, process it remotely, then send back a preview or export. Browser-native editors do the decoding, effects, and encoding right there in your tab.
The technology behind the second model is fairly new. WebCodecs handles video decoding and encoding, WebAssembly (WASM) runs near-native-speed code inside the browser, and WebGPU gives the browser direct access to your device’s graphics card for effects and rendering. Put together, these three browser APIs let editors run decoding, GPU-accelerated effects, and encoding entirely client-side, without ever uploading the raw file. WebGPU in particular is the piece that changed the math: it’s mature enough now that browser-native tools can push real GPU work to the user’s own device instead of renting server GPUs for every job.
Here’s how the trade-offs shake out:
- Server-rendered: handles heavier jobs well, but adds upload time, queueing delays, and ongoing server costs that often get passed to you as subscription price.
- Browser-native: near-instant previews, better privacy since files can stay local, and lower operating cost, but it depends on your device’s own graphics hardware.
- Hybrid setups exist too, where some browser editors act as a front-end for server-side rendering while others do the full job client-side, a distinction worth checking before you commit to a tool.
The practical result: your everyday cuts, captions, and color tweaks now happen in the same tab where you found the editor, with none of the round-trip lag that defined browser editing a few years ago.

When Should You Choose a Browser Editor Over a Native App?
Browser editors are the right call for short-form social clips, quick training videos, family memory reels, classroom assignments, and marketing snippets that need to go out fast. These are jobs measured in minutes of footage, not hours, and speed usually beats raw editing depth.
Where they hit a wall: heavy visual effects work, multi-camera 4K RAW workflows, film-grade color grading, and anything leaning on specialized plugins. Desktop non-linear editors still hold the edge for multi-cam, RAW, and node-based color grading, while cloud workstation setups let bigger teams rent GPU-powered virtual machines instead of buying one.
The simple rule: if the project fits in a weekend and needs to move fast, use the browser. If it needs a production pipeline, look elsewhere.
How Do Teams Collaborate Without Downloading Files?
Feedback used to mean emailing a file, waiting for a download, and hoping the reviewer’s player didn’t choke on the codec. Browser-based platforms replace that with:
- Timestamped comments pinned to the exact frame someone’s reacting to.
- Version history, so nobody is guessing which cut is current.
- A shared media library everyone pulls from instead of scattered local copies.
- Role-based access that limits who can edit versus who can only comment.
A typical review cycle looks like this:
- Upload the draft or share a link.
- Reviewers leave timestamped comments directly on the timeline.
- The editor applies changes without re-uploading the whole project.
- The final cut exports and gets repurposed for other platforms.
None of this requires anyone to download a multi-gigabyte file. Cloud video editing systems combine editing software, cloud storage, and streaming preview so reviewers watch a stream instead of downloading, and that single environment cuts down the version chaos that comes from five people editing five copies of the same file.
